Eduardo Karahanian is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Neurology. According to data from OpenAlex, Eduardo Karahanian has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 704 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Molecular Biology, 9 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and 9 papers in Neurology. Recurrent topics in Eduardo Karahanian’s work include Neuroinflammation and Neurodegeneration Mechanisms (8 papers), Alcohol Consumption and Health Effects (7 papers) and Neurotransmitter Receptor Influence on Behavior (7 papers). Eduardo Karahanian is often cited by papers focused on Neuroinflammation and Neurodegeneration Mechanisms (8 papers), Alcohol Consumption and Health Effects (7 papers) and Neurotransmitter Receptor Influence on Behavior (7 papers). Eduardo Karahanian collaborates with scholars based in Chile, United States and Argentina. Eduardo Karahanian's co-authors include Marı́a Elena Quintanilla, Yedy Israel, Mario Rivera‐Meza, Mario Herrera‐Marschitz, Lutske Tampier, Sergio Lobos, Katherine García, Carlos Puebla, Paola Morales and Rafael Vicuña and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ied and Environmental Microbiology, Gene and Neuropharmacology.
